For your wife who is passionate about philosophy and existentialism, finding a meaningful Valentine's Day gift that aligns with her interests will surely make her heart soar. Consider these ideas to celebrate your love while embracing her intellectual pursuits:
1. Classic Philosophical Texts: Explore the works of renowned philosophers like Friedrich Nietzsche, Jean-Paul Sartre, or Albert Camus. Select a few influential titles or her favorite philosopher's magnum opus, and present her with a beautifully bound edition. This gesture demonstrates your thoughtfulness towards her passion, while allowing her to delve deeper into the philosophical world.
2. Philosophy or Existentialism Course: Enroll her in an online course or workshop that explores philosophy or existentialism. Many reputable platforms offer in-depth courses by renowned professionals, allowing her to learn and engage with the subject matter on a new level. This gift provides an opportunity for personal growth and intellectual stimulation.
3. Philosophy-inspired Jewelry: Surprise her with a unique piece of jewelry that embodies her love for philosophy. Opt for a pendant featuring a quote or symbol from her favorite philosopher or a piece representing an idea central to existentialism. This exquisite gift will not only serve as a reminder of her passion but also symbolize your understanding and support.
4. Personal library or bookshelf upgrade: Help her create a beautiful space to showcase her philosophical books by upgrading her personal library or bookshelf. You can find stylish and aesthetic bookshelves or even have a custom-made one to cater to her taste. Add some decor elements like inspirational quotes, bookmarks, or philosophical art pieces to make it a truly personalized and cherished space.
5. Philosophical Artwork: Search for artwork that captures the essence of philosophy or existentialism. Look for pieces inspired by famous philosophical concepts or quotes. Whether it's a painting, sculpture, or even a customized piece, this gift will not only adorn your home but also ignite conversations about her passion whenever she looks at it.
6. Thought-provoking Subscription Box: Surprise her with a subscription box that aligns with her interests. There are various monthly subscription boxes available that cater to the intellectually curious, offering books, philosophical diaries, puzzles, or discussion guides. This gift will keep her engaged with philosophy long after Valentine's Day has passed.
7. Passionate Discussion & Quality Time: Sometimes, the most meaningful gift is simply spending quality time together and engaging in passionate discussions. Plan a date night where you can immerse yourselves in deep conversations about philosophy and existentialism. Choose a cozy setting, maybe with a fireplace and a bottle of her favorite wine, to create a warm and intimate atmosphere that promotes thoughtful exchanges between the two of you.
Remember, the most important aspect of any gift is the thought and love behind it. By showing an understanding and appreciation for your wife's passion for philosophy and existentialism, you are not only celebrating her interests but also strengthening the bond between you as a couple.
